Joshua 3:2 Meaning and Commentary

Joshua 3:2

And it came to pass after three days
At the end of the three days they were bid to prepare food for their expedition, and to go over Jordan, ( Joshua 1:11 ) ;

that the officers went through the host;
the camp of Israel; very probably the same as in ( Joshua 1:10 ) ; this was, no doubt, by the order of Joshua, and who was directed to it by the Lord.

Joshua 3:2 In-Context

1 Joshua rose early in the morning, and they set out from Acacia Grove. And they came up to the Jordan, he and all the {Israelites}, and they spent the night there before they crossed [over].
2 At the end of the three days the officers passed through the midst of the camp,
3 and they commanded the people: "When you see the Levitical priests carrying the ark of the covenant of Yahweh your God you must set out from your place and go after it.
4 [But] there will be a distance between you and it of about two thousand cubits in measurement. Do not come near it, so that you may know the way that you must go, for you have not passed on [this] way {before}."
5 And Joshua said to the people, "Sanctify yourselves, because tomorrow Yahweh will do wonders in your midst."
